Pre-race ticket options put fans at center of the action at The Glen

WATKINS GLEN, NY (April 26, 2016) – Cheez-It™ 355 ticket-holders can take their race day experience to the next level on Sunday, August 7th with the purchase of a $100 pre-race access pass for NASCAR Sprint Cup Series driver introductions.

“Our fans have been asking for an opportunity to see their favorite drivers up close during pre-race ceremonies, and we’re thrilled to be able to offer this type of upgrade ahead of this summer’s race weekend. With the access pass, fans will be positioned on the track, directly in front of the stage” said Watkins Glen International President Michael Printup.

The new pass includes exclusive entry to a dedicated area on the track in front of the pre-race stage that provides close-up views of celebrities, dignitaries, special presentations, and NASCAR Sprint Cup Series driver introductions, in addition to admission to the cold pit area on Sunday morning.

For fans that have already purchased a Fan Walk, a $50 upgrade to the pre-race access is available by calling 1-866-461-RACE. Passes and tickets to the Cheez-It™ 355 can also be purchased by visiting www.theglen.com. A valid Sunday ticket is required to purchase any pre-race option.

The NASCAR Sprint Cup Series returns to Watkins Glen International August 4-7 for the Cheez-It™ 355 race weekend, which also features the NASCAR K&N Pro Series East Bully Hill Vineyards 100, and the NASCAR XFINITY Series Zippo 200.
